Ford 428 Cobra Jet on dyno - with Survival FE stroker kit and dual quads
Ford 428 Cobra Jet with dual quads. Stroked to 462 cubes with a Survival Motorsports "Prison Break" 4.250 stroked kit. Hydraulic roller cam with .598 lift. Compression at 10.8:1, running factory iron 428CJ heads with modest port work and bigger valves. Pump premium 93 octane unleaded.
Engine made 543 horsepower at 5600RPM and 561 torque with a dead flat torque band from 4000 to 4800. Idles with a nice chop at 800.

This 1969 Ford Mustang Mach I Drag Pack Super Cobra Jet has a 427 4 bolt main engine block with 428 crank and rods. The reason I opted for the 427 block is because of the 4 bolt mains and a little secret that few folks know. The 428 blocks cracked on the # 2 main web; thus, it let the engine lose oil pressure resulting in catastrophic failure. Even the guys that campaigned the 428Cobra Jet engine for Ford Motor Company did not run 428 blocks. The engine is balanced and blueprinted. The car was rotisserie restored.
